Collection filter for genres cannot be stored
#1
I'd like to select my songs for genres.
Therefore I add the new genre guitar to the genres available.
Next I select a song and add that genre to it - so far everything works fine.
Next step is generating a new collection (let's say name Guitar Songs), which lists songs only that are tagged with the genre guitar.
So far, this works fine.
Now I enter the Save key, and the collection lost the genre filter setting.
I couldn't find a way to handle this.
Neither in Windows 11 nor in Android 13.
I think, there's an implementation bug.

Am I wright or wrong?

Any filter that is set in the group editor is a temporary thing that will be cleared when you leave the group editor unless you uncheck Settings->Library Settings->Reset Filters After Exiting Group Editor. Then any filter change you make will remain when you return to the library screen. I'm guessing that's the problem here, but if it's not, I'm going to need more information on how you are generating the collection, as there are many different ways to go about doing that. Also, please be aware that filters are not set per-group. The filter is applied to every tab on the library screen and to whatever group is currently selected on a group tab. These filters are cleared if you restart the app unless you enable the option to automatically load last used filters at startup.

Thank you very much for the response. Disabling the ->Reset Filters After Exiting Group Editor as well as activating the latest filter settings changes a lot.
I'm exploring - it looks much better now.
